💻从零开始做远控 | 第六篇:屏幕监控 📱
发布时间:2025-03-16 17:46:05来源:网易
想要实现屏幕监控功能?今天继续用C语言和Socket编程带你一步步搞定!屏幕监控是远程控制中非常重要的功能之一,它能让用户实时查看目标设备的屏幕状态,就像拥有了一双“千里眼”。
首先,我们需要了解基本原理:通过Socket建立网络连接后,将屏幕数据打包发送到客户端。这需要对屏幕进行截图,并将图像数据压缩传输,减少带宽占用。在代码实现上,可以利用Windows API获取屏幕内容(如`BitBlt`),再结合套接字函数(如`send`)完成数据传递。当然,为了提升效率,还可以引入Zlib等库来压缩图像数据,进一步优化性能。
不过要注意,屏幕监控涉及隐私问题,务必合法合规使用哦!💡小提示:记得处理好异常情况,比如网络中断或权限不足等问题。跟着教程动手实践吧,相信你很快就能掌握这项技能!✨
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。